How does Lambertville, NJ compare to Greenwich CDP (Warren County), New Jersey, NJ? Lambertville has a population of 4,141 with a median household income of $106,236, while Greenwich CDP (Warren County), New Jersey has 2,615 residents and a median income of $166,977.
